Job description

Overview

Multi-Partner Consortium to Expand Dementia Research in Latin (ReDLat) aims to combine genomic, neuroimaging, behavioral, and social determinants of health data to improve dementia characterization and identify novel treatments in diverse populations across Argentina, Brazil, Colombia, Chile, Mexico, and Peru. The project collaborates with UCSF Fein Memory and Aging Center, UCSF Santa Barbara, and HudsonAlpha to advance research on Alzheimer’s disease and frontotemporal dementia.

Job Summary

The International Program Coordinator provides administrative and program management for the ReDLat study, coordinating international subcontracts, managing budgets, supporting grant proposals, and facilitating collaboration among researchers and committees.

Responsibilities
  • Subcontract Preparation and Amendments
    • Guide sites through budget preparation, justifications, scopes of work, and fund-advance budgets for new subcontracts
    • Coordinate subcontract budget amendments and correspondence with UCSF pre‑award and post‑award teams
    • Gather IRB approvals, hardship letters, PI assurances, and registration numbers
    • Provide guidance on invoice templates and procedures and maintain an internal database of subcontract invoices
  • Fiscal and Budget Oversight
    • Review all subcontract invoices for accuracy before submission for payment
    • Meet with sites to address budget and invoice questions
  • Coordinate Research Committees
    • Maintain accurate email lists, schedule meetings, and prepare agendas
    • Manage agenda during calls, take notes, track action items, and follow up
    • Manage review of collaboration requests
  • Assist with Annual Meeting Preparations
    • Prepare invitations, manage attendee lists, draft agendas, arrange speakers, and coordinate travel
  • Manage Database Access Requests
    • Liaise with investigators and the Industry Contracts Division for new data use agreements
    • Request and track accounts for new users in Fein Memory and Aging Center databases
  • Grant Writing Support
    • Interface with UCSF pre‑award team, manage grant submission timelines, and prepare subaward documents
    • Draft budgets, budget justifications, NIH biosketches, letters of support, and IRB and administrative documents
Qualifications
  • Required Qualifications
    • Bachelor’s degree in a related area and minimum three years of experience or equivalent training
    • Strong interpersonal skills, including verbal and written communication, active listening, critical thinking, persuasion, and counseling
    • Discretion and ability to maintain confidentiality
    • Strong short‑term planning, analysis, problem‑solving, and customer service skills
    • Willingness to travel internationally
  • Preferred Qualifications
    • Thorough knowledge of University rules and regulations, budgeting, accounting, and personnel management procedures
    • Solid knowledge of common university‑specific computer applications
    • Knowledge of financial analysis and reporting techniques and human resources policies for staff and academic employees
    • Spanish language skills
    • Portuguese language skills
    • Experience with NIH grant finances
